WebApr 21, 2024 · Marjorie Kinnan Rawlings (August 8, 1896 – December 14, 1953) was an American novelist and memoirist best known for The Yearling (1938), the story of a boy who adopts an orphaned fawn, and the hard choices that ensue.. The Yearling won the Pulitzer Prize for Fiction in 1939 and was made into a successful movie in 1946.. … WebThe Yearling Introduction You think you've got problems? WebThe Yearling is a 1938 novel written by American author Marjorie Kinnan Rawlings (1896-1953). The book won a Pulitzer Prize for fiction in 1939. The novel was adapted for the movie by screenwriter Paul Osborne. It was remade into a TV movie, also called The Yearling (1994) in 1994. Edit
